One of the most frequent problems that can occur with uPVC windows is that they become difficult to lock or open. This is usually the case when the locking mechanism has become stiff or stuck. If this is the case, an easy fix is to utilize graphite powder or machine oil to grease the lock and handle mechanism. This will enable the mechanism to be freed up and allow the window or door to operate normally once more.

The hinges may also become stiff or stuck. This issue is usually caused by grit and dust building on the hinges. Lubricating the hinges using grease or oil is the solution. The wrong grease, however, could lead to damage and may render the hinges inoperable.

Cracks in the leaded glass may be caused by vibrations, thermal expansion or contraction building movements, or normal wear and tear. Over time, the cracks may expand and cause more problems. To prevent further damage and enlargement any crack that crosses an important feature of a stained-glass panel or the face should be repaired as quickly as possible. In the past, this was accomplished by cutting an "Dutchman's" lead flange over the crack. This technique was a poor solution, and today there are better ways to repair these types of cracks.

Stained glass restoration can take on many forms. It can be as easy as repairing cracks, or as complicated as restoring a complete stained glass window or door panel back to its original condition. Generally speaking, the cost of a restoration project is considerably higher than a simple repair or Windows Repair replacement. This is due to the fact that the process involves cleaning and removing damaged or stained glass, tightening the lead cames, resealing and re-tying the cement, and replacing broken p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ping blocks air and water from entering homes through the gaps surrounding doors and windows. It is an essential aspect of home maintenance that could help you save money on cost of energy and costly repairs. It also makes homes more comfortable. However, the materials used to create this seal can deteriorate as time passes due to wear and tear, making it necessary to replace the seals from time to time.

You can detect whether your weather stripping has worn out by noticing a wet spot after washing the windows, a whistling noise while driving, or a draft that you feel in front of a closed-door. All of these are good indications to find an expert near me who offers weatherstripping repairs.

Taskers can employ various weatherstripping products to seal your windows and doors. Foam tapes are made from closed cell or open-cell foam. They are available in a variety of sizes, thicknesses, and widths. They are easy to install and can be easily cut using scissors. Felt strips are also inexpensive and usually last for about a year or two. You can cut them to size using scissors, and attach them to the frame of your door, hinge side, or sliding window using staples, glue, or tacks. Metal or vinyl V-strips are somewhat more difficult to set up, but they can be nailed in the window jamb.
